Transaction ef37475401fad6aaa67fe0de920b83675d6e6ca1fd6e9a91f4361e9e4c80c5fb
1 Input
1 Output
-
ef37475401fad6aaa67fe0de920b83675d6e6ca1fd6e9a91f4361e9e4c80c5fb:0
- value
- 2520849
- script pubkey
- OP_0 OP_PUSHBYTES_20 273977b2a41920d89564b1ad2f876f1ac30ac52a
- address
- bc1qyuuh0v4yrysd39tykxkjlpm0rtps43f2s97eu0